Tin can foil dinner ingredients
As I've already mentioned, you lot tin can choose to utilise almost any combination of ingredients and flavors in tin can foil dinners, but here are a few guidelines to consider:
- Cull a poly peptide— For these tin foil dinners I used ground beefiness, merely ground turkey, chicken, sausage, cubed chicken or steak, fish, or shrimp would also work. The meat should be able to cook rapidly, and so a whole chicken chest or pork chop are not platonic.
- Add lots of veggies— For every 1 cup of protein, effort to add 2 cups (or more) of veggies. You tin utilise just a few or a larger diversity, it'south up to you lot! These can foil dinners have onions, potatoes, carrots, corn, and green beans. Feel free to use either fresh or frozen vegetables.
- Choose a seasoning— Continue it simple with simply salt and pepper, or add other seasonings like garlic pulverisation, dried or fresh herbs, or your favorite multi-purpose seasoning salt. My favorite way to burst season in tin foil dinners is with fresh herbs like rosemary, thyme or sage.
- End with butter or oil— Add a few pats of butter or a drizzle of olive oil for another boost of season and to aid foreclose the contents from sticking to the foil.
How to assemble tin foil dinners
- Starting time with heavy duty aluminum foil and measure sheets to near xviii inches long.
- Lay sheets of foil side-by-side on your workspace so you can get together all at one time.
- Grease foil with nonstick cooking spray.
- Split up meat and veggies evenly betwixt each sheet of foil, mounding them into the center.
- Superlative with butter or drizzle of oil.
- Flavour with salt, pepper and any additional seasonings.
- Fold the long ends of the foil together, crimping them tightly to create a seal, and and so continue to fold the seam over itself until it's flush with the contents. Fold over and crimp both sides the same mode. You want the foil to be tightly sealed so no juices escape.
- If you're cooking over a burn down or grill, consider double wrapping the tin foil dinner to ensure they can agree upwardly during cooking without tearing open. Tongs can accidentally pierce open the foil as you flip and rotate information technology, and double wrapping can forbid that.
Tin foil dinners tin be assembled ahead of time and stored in the fridge or cooler until you're ready to cook. Brand sure they stay properly chilled and try to utilise them inside a few days. You can also freeze can foil dinners up to several weeks ahead of time (it's a bang-up way to go along them common cold in a libation!). Allow thaw in the fridge overnight or in a cooler for several hours before cooking.
3 ways to cook tin foil dinners
You tin can cook these beef and veggie can foil dinners several dissimilar ways:
- Over a bivouac— (aka my favorite mode) Look till fire has turned to coals and spread logs out slightly to brand a flat surface, or place logs in a circle around a apartment space in the center. Place tin foil dinners in the burn down and cook for most 20 minutes, flipping and/or rotating packets during cooking as needed.
- On the grill— Preheat grill to medium, or to most 400°F. Place tin foil dinners on grill and cook for 20 minutes, flipping once during cooking.
- In the oven— Preheat oven to 400°F. Identify tin foil dinners on a sheet pan and cook for about 20 minutes.
Cooking time for tin foil dinners will depend on the size of meat and veggies and how full the packets are. Aim for i-inch pieces and the dinners should be done in virtually 20 minutes. You lot tin can always open a packet to check for doneness and return it to the fire/grill/oven if more cooking time is needed.

Beef and Veggie Tin Foil Dinners
These tasty beefiness and veggie tin foil dinners are a consummate and hearty meal wrapped up in foil and cooked over a fire, on the grill, or in the oven.
- 1 lb ground beef
- 2 large carrots , sliced
- 1 ear of corn , kernels removed (or 1 cup frozen)
- 1 lb potatoes (nearly 4 medium), chopped in 1 inch pieces
- Scattering of green beans , chopped
- 1/two minor onion , chopped
- 1/4 loving cup salted butter , cubed (can also use i/iv cup olive oil)
- Approximately ane tablespoon fresh rosemary thyme or sage , chopped
- Salt and pepper , as needed
-
Measure 4 sheets of heavy duty aluminum foil to about 18 inches. Spray with nonstick cooking spray.
-
Layer beef and veggies in a mound into the center of each sheet of foil, dividing ingredients evenly between all 4 sheets.
-
Top with butter or oil and fresh herbs.
-
Flavour heavily with salt and pepper, well-nigh 1/two teaspoon of common salt for each packet.
-
Fold edges of foil over and crimp tightly to seal. If cooking on grill or burn down, consider double wrapping to prevent tears in foil.
-
To cook on fire:
Look till fire has turned to coals and spread logs out to oestrus is as even equally possible. Cook on logs for nearly 20 minutes, flipping and rotating as needed to promote even cooking, until meat is cooked through and veggies are soft.
-
To melt on grill:
Preheat grill to medium heat, about 400° and cook for 20 minutes, flipping halfway through, until meat is cooked through and veggies are soft.
-
To cook in oven:
Preheat oven to 400°F and cook for 20 minutes or until meat is cooked through and veggies are soft.
-
Advisedly open up upward foil packets as the steam inside is very hot. You tin consume direct out of the foil or dump contents onto a plate.
NOTES:
- See post above for suggestions of other flavor and ingredient combinations.
- To make ahead: Store prepared foil dinner in a fridge or cooler for a few days, or store in the freezer for several weeks. Let thaw in the fridge overnight or in a cooler for several hours before cooking. Always make sure prepared foil dinners are kept cold earlier cooking.
